Property wealth boost

Older homeowners receive £1.94 billion

Older homeowners received a £1.94 billion property wealth boost in the first half of 2021, data shows[1]. More than half of the proceeds of equity release (52%) were used to clear mortgages (45%) and manage unsecured debts (7%) while 23% was used to help family and friends – notably for help with house deposits as buyers rushed to beat the end of the Stamp Duty holiday.

Financial futures

Gen Xers expected to face significant challenges in retirement

With many ‘Gen Xers’ (those born between 1965 and 1980) having entered the job market too late to benefit from final salary pensions, yet too early to benefit from schemes such as auto-enrolment, this group is expected to face significant challenges in retirement, if policymakers fail to respond urgently.
